Output 31ebcb58af52c22158fd2799010aef27ea772f3154822489146add2c94a2343a:1

value
3673116399
script pubkey
OP_0 OP_PUSHBYTES_20 c6caac5826c50fa7ea8e86613df30a7d69d8297e
address
tb1qcm92ckpxc586065wsesnmuc2045as2t7ah2z0a
transaction
31ebcb58af52c22158fd2799010aef27ea772f3154822489146add2c94a2343a
spent
true